What makes a roof truly wind-resistant for Laughlin's monsoon season?
Laughlin's 115 mph Ultimate Wind Speed Zone requires specific engineering. Class 4 impact-resistant shingles withstand hail and debris during July-September monsoons, preventing the small punctures that lead to major leaks. Proper installation includes high-wind rated fasteners every 6 inches at the perimeter. These upgrades qualify for insurance discounts while providing genuine protection against monsoon damage.

What are the current roofing code requirements for Laughlin homes?
Clark County Building & Fire Prevention enforces the 2018 IRC with 2021 Southern Nevada Amendments. These codes now mandate specific ice and water shield offsets at eaves and valleys, plus enhanced flashing details at penetrations. All work requires permits and must be performed by Nevada State Contractors Board licensed professionals. These 2026 requirements address monsoon-driven water intrusion patterns observed in local homes.

Can a visual inspection really find all the problems with my concrete tile roof?
Traditional walk-over inspections miss 40% of moisture issues in concrete tile systems. Infrared thermal imaging detects sub-surface moisture in the plywood decking by identifying temperature differentials. This technology reveals trapped moisture from failed sealants or cracked tiles before visible damage appears. Early detection prevents structural rot and reduces repair costs significantly.
How does roof pitch affect attic ventilation in Laughlin's heat?
Your 4/12 low-slope roof creates ventilation challenges that can lead to attic mold. The 2018 IRC with 2021 Southern Nevada Amendments requires specific intake and exhaust ratios to prevent moisture buildup. Improper venting allows monsoon humidity to condense on plywood decking, accelerating deterioration. Balanced ventilation maintains consistent attic temperatures year-round, protecting your roof structure.
